They look more like Jazzmasters to me.
Also, I think they messed up the name of this pedal... Maybe they ment Brown Source or Big Cheese?
J. Mascis wrote: "The Meatball is on almost every song, " he adds. "It's a crazy distortion box that's made by this company called Lovetone in England. Kevin Shields (of My Bloody Valentine) turned me on to them. I use it for everything from slight overdrive to fullfuzz."
